What is the difference between Internship Event Setup Crew vs Event Setup Assistant?

AspectInternship Event Setup CrewEvent Setup Assistant
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; on-the-job trainingHigh school diploma or equivalent; some experience preferred
Work EnvironmentEvent venues, outdoor and indoor settings, physically activeEvent venues, often indoors, physically active
Employer & IndustryEvent planning companies, venues, festivalsEvent planning companies, venues, corporate events
Search & Comparison IntentEntry-level, hands-on event setup rolesAssisting with event setup tasks, supporting event staff

The Internship Event Setup Crew typically involves entry-level, physically active roles focused on assisting with event setup tasks under supervision. The Event Setup Assistant may have similar responsibilities but often requires some prior experience and may support more complex setup activities. Both roles are essential in the event industry, providing hands-on support for successful event execution.

Job description

Overview
Auburn Athletics is excited to begin the search for a Special Event Intern! Interns with the Auburn Athletics Special Event Crew assist with the planning and execution of special events, as well as any administrative duties necessary.
Responsibilities
• Assist with the planning and execution of special events.
• Learn and become familiar with all Auburn Athletics venues.
• Form relationships with vendors and clients.
• Assist in daily administrative duties such as filing, copying, and printing.
• Assist in the guidance of setup and breakdown for special events.
• Assist Event Coordinator.
Qualifications
Enrolled student at Auburn University
Minimum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
• Ability to work in variable weather conditions with loud crowd noise
• Ability to work both weekdays and weekends, 10-20 hours a week
• Ability to work during all Auburn Athletics home games
• Ability to lift at least 50 pounds
• Working knowledge of the following Microsoft Office programs: Word, Excel PowerPoint, and Outlook, as well as basic audio-visual knowledge
• Ability to independently interpret and follow any verbal or written instruction, including floorplan and event details, with minimal supervision.
